A Study on Effect of Guar Biodegradable Biopolymer on Soil Wind Erosion

The present study investigated the effect of guar biopolymer on soil wind erosion. Assuming that Guar gum can control wind erosion, its ability to reduce soil wind erosion was examined by wind tunnel tests. Examined soil samples were gathered from sandy hills of Segzi plain, located in Isfahan Province. Then were prepared in plates with diameter of 23 cm treated with guar gum suspension so that 0.2, 0.4, 0.8, 1 and 1.2 gr of the biopolymer were scattered per square meter of sample surface. Wind tunnel tests were performed on samples at speed of 7 m/s to 15 m/s. The test results indicated that the resistant crust formed on soil surface due to spraying Guar suspension can highly increase soil resistance to wind erosion. 1.2 gr/m2 of Guar can reduce erosion up to 98 percent. Soil sieving analysis results pointed out that Guar gum causes enlargement of the soil aggregates and so in reduction of erosion and raise in threshold wind velocity from 7 to 10 m/s. Thus, using Guar gum can be considered as a suitable method for controlling soil wind erosion, after the field experiments.
